The Stranger Things fandom is buzzing again after a resurfaced theory suggested that Vecna, not Will, was the one communicating with Joyce through the flickering lights in season 1. The recently dropped Stranger Things 5 trailer added fuel to the fire, showing what appears to be the Demogorgon handing Will over to Vecna. Fans are now rewatching scenes with new eyes, convinced that Vecna was manipulating events in Hawkins long before anyone even knew his name.

What is making the theory so divisive is how deeply it rewrites the show’s emotional heartbeat. If Vecna orchestrated Will’s kidnapping and used the lights to toy with Joyce, while fans thought she was the unsung hero of season 1, that means their entire connection was never love, it was manipulation. Add to that the twist from Stranger Things: The First Shadow, revealing Joyce and Vecna’s high school link, and every rescue moment suddenly feels like a setup for a twisted psychological finale.

Another chilling layer to the theory is how Vecna’s powers mirror the strange light phenomena around Joyce and Will. Fans noticed that, unlike Demogorgons who make lights flicker, Vecna causes them to glow brighter before dimming, exactly what happened when Joyce saw the lights move in a circle around Holly. That circle test was performed in the Hawkins lab under Henry Creel’s watch, suggesting Vecna may have been experimenting with manipulating the real world long before he became a monster.

And then comes the sleeper agent angle, the one turning the fandom upside down. The theory argues that Vecna used Will as a vessel to infiltrate Hawkins: he was possessed by the shadow, brought the Mind Flayer’s essence into the world, and unknowingly laid the groundwork for Vecna’s army. Joyce may have freed him, but traces of Vecna’s influence could still remain. If that is true, Stranger Things 5 is not just a rescue mission; it is Vecna’s endgame finally playing out.
